The effect of feedback novelty on neural correlates of feedback processing.
Brain and Cognition ( IF 2.2 ) Pub Date : 2020-08-07 , DOI: 10.1016/j.bandc.2020.105610
Benjamin Ernst 1 , Marco Steinhauser 1
Affiliation  

It has been suggested that stimulus novelty itself can be rewarding and recent evidence suggests that novelty processing and reward processing share common neural mechanisms. For feedback processing, this can be beneficial as well as detrimental: If novelty lends a rewarding characteristic to a stimulus, then this should particularly decrease the impact of negative feedback. The present study investigated whether such an effect of feedback novelty on feedback processing is reflected in electrophysiological markers of reinforcement learning (feedback-related negativity, FRN) and feedback processing (feedback-P300) in a simple decision-making task. In this task, participants had to chose between two stimuli in a learning trial followed by a novel or a familiar feedback stimulus. Learning from feedback allowed them to optimize their payoff in a later test trial. As expected, we found that the FRN effect, i.e. the difference between the FRN amplitudes after negative and positive feedback, was reduced for novel compared to familiar feedback stimuli. In addition, the amplitude of the feedback-P300 was decreased by feedback novelty, both for the anterior P3a and the posterior P3b. Together, these results indicate that feedback novelty can affect feedback processing as reflected by feedback-related brain activity.

反馈新颖性对反馈处理的神经相关性的影响。



有人认为,刺激新颖性本身就可以带来回报,最近的证据表明,新颖性处理和奖励处理具有共同的神经机制。对于反馈处理来说,这可能是有益的,也可能是有害的:如果新颖性给刺激带来了有益的特征,那么这应该特别减少负面反馈的影响。本研究调查了反馈新颖性对反馈处理的这种影响是否反映在简单决策任务中强化学习(反馈相关负性,FRN)和反馈处理(反馈-P300)的电生理标记中。在这项任务中,参与者必须在学习试验中的两种刺激之间进行选择,然后选择一种新颖的或熟悉的反馈刺激。从反馈中学习使他们能够在以后的测试中优化他们的回报。正如预期的那样,我们发现与熟悉的反馈刺激相比,新颖的 FRN 效应(即负反馈和正反馈后 FRN 幅度之间的差异)减小了。此外,前 P3a 和后 P3b 的反馈 P300 幅度均因反馈新颖性而降低。总之,这些结果表明,反馈新颖性可以影响反馈处理,如反馈相关的大脑活动所反映的那样。
